Cleary Gottlieb: what the official sources say about selection

1 governed signal from 1 official source record, observed 14 September 2026. An evidence record lists what the register holds for one institution; it is not a dossier and it does not describe a complete selection process.

Markets recorded: United States. Categories: Candidate selection factors / GPA policy.

LimitThe signals below are what Cleary Gottlieb published on the observation dates, coded one programme, market and date at a time. They do not establish hidden screening criteria, university weighting, acceptance odds or a universal process across offices.

United States

1 signal

SIG-218 Official source Cleary Gottlieb

Cleary says summer-associate hiring decisions consider prior work experience, judgment, interpersonal skills and demonstrated academic performance, and do not rely primarily on a minimum GPA requirement.

Evidence passage recorded against the sourceOur hiring decisions are based on many factors, including prior work experience, outstanding judgment, interpersonal skills and demonstrated high academic performance in both your legal and undergraduate studies. We do not rely primarily on a minimum GPA requirement.
